公用事業(yè)級(jí)全球互聯(lián)網(wǎng)的興起使網(wǎng)絡(luò)邊緣的一些真正令人驚嘆的創(chuàng)新成為可能。在數(shù)據(jù)中心和用戶手中運(yùn)行的所有跨網(wǎng)絡(luò)通信的技術(shù)都經(jīng)歷了一場(chǎng)深刻的革命。服務(wù)器和桌面虛擬化、云計(jì)算、基礎(chǔ)設(shè)施即服務(wù) (IaaS)、軟件即服務(wù) (SaaS)、智能設(shè)備和移動(dòng)應(yīng)用生態(tài)系統(tǒng)是這場(chǎng)革命的證據(jù)。對(duì)用戶的文化影響被稱為 IT 消費(fèi)化——期望所有信息技術(shù)都應(yīng)該快速、簡(jiǎn)單和自助。所有這一切的發(fā)生都是因?yàn)榛ヂ?lián)網(wǎng)充當(dāng)了通信平臺(tái)和推動(dòng)者。
互聯(lián)網(wǎng)不僅使人類(lèi)通過(guò)計(jì)算和通信設(shè)備進(jìn)行使用和通信變得容易,而且還使嵌入式計(jì)算設(shè)備(物)之間的數(shù)據(jù)通信成為可能。實(shí)現(xiàn)物聯(lián)網(wǎng) (IoT) 的關(guān)鍵互聯(lián)網(wǎng)發(fā)展之一是大量增加的 IPv6 地址空間的實(shí)際可用性。物聯(lián)網(wǎng)包含各種各樣的用例。一種是與家用電器、照明、電源、供暖/制冷、娛樂(lè)和安全設(shè)備連接的家庭,所有這些都支持互聯(lián)網(wǎng)以相互通信,并管理監(jiān)控、警報(bào)、調(diào)度和執(zhí)行預(yù)配置策略的應(yīng)用程序。其他用例包括聯(lián)網(wǎng)汽車(chē)、應(yīng)用傳感器監(jiān)控公用電網(wǎng)、能源管道或制造工廠中數(shù)千甚至數(shù)百萬(wàn)個(gè)點(diǎn)的工業(yè)應(yīng)用。
物聯(lián)網(wǎng)對(duì)網(wǎng)絡(luò)必須如何工作的影響是巨大的。首先,連接端點(diǎn)數(shù)量的指數(shù)級(jí)增長(zhǎng)將創(chuàng)建令人難以置信的規(guī)模和復(fù)雜性的網(wǎng)絡(luò)。還有一個(gè)真正的服務(wù)質(zhì)量(QoS)問(wèn)題。當(dāng)您有這么多不同的機(jī)器對(duì)機(jī)器 (M2M) 流量與傳統(tǒng)的基于人的用例一起發(fā)生時(shí),您如何有效地優(yōu)先處理流量?例如,一個(gè)家庭健康監(jiān)測(cè)系統(tǒng)具有分布式設(shè)備,可以測(cè)量各種病人和老年人的環(huán)境條件,閉門(mén)病人絕對(duì)應(yīng)該優(yōu)先于大多數(shù)其他流量,尤其是當(dāng)檢測(cè)到有問(wèn)題時(shí)。因此,物聯(lián)網(wǎng)看起來(lái)將成為采用 SDN 的驅(qū)動(dòng)力。
網(wǎng)絡(luò)功能虛擬化
網(wǎng)絡(luò)功能虛擬化 (NFV) 從某種意義上說(shuō)非常簡(jiǎn)單,您可以將其簡(jiǎn)化為以下三個(gè)步驟:
1.采用任何執(zhí)行或?qū)儆诰W(wǎng)絡(luò)服務(wù)的功能(例如防火墻、負(fù)載均衡器、流量?jī)?yōu)化器或 LTE 移動(dòng)控制平面網(wǎng)關(guān))
2.從專用硬件設(shè)備中刪除該功能,這些設(shè)備通常利用率嚴(yán)重不足,并且很難與其他設(shè)備組合管理,因?yàn)闄C(jī)架和電纜設(shè)備需要時(shí)間和物理空間
3.將該功能置于虛擬機(jī) (VM) 上,其硬件資源可以通過(guò)軟件進(jìn)行彈性管理,并且可以通過(guò)軟件相當(dāng)容易地串聯(lián)或服務(wù)鏈配置
NFV 的好處歸結(jié)為以下幾點(diǎn):
?您可以快速、靈活地創(chuàng)建服務(wù)鏈,而無(wú)需經(jīng)過(guò)硬件管理流程,這意味著您可以在更具競(jìng)爭(zhēng)力的時(shí)間范圍內(nèi)從概念或客戶請(qǐng)求到實(shí)施。
?您可以靈活地管理硬件容量,這在考慮到流量可能會(huì)因一天中的時(shí)間、一周中的某一天和特殊事件而有很大差異時(shí)尤其重要。
?您可以將其中許多功能轉(zhuǎn)移到商品化的數(shù)據(jù)中心硬件上,遠(yuǎn)離許多單獨(dú)的專用設(shè)備,從而在您整合培訓(xùn)、升級(jí)和管理系統(tǒng)時(shí)降低資本支出 (CAPEX) 和運(yùn)營(yíng)支出 (OPEX),并獲得更大的收益大型數(shù)據(jù)中心設(shè)備與單個(gè)設(shè)備的效率。
NFV 的技術(shù)影響之一來(lái)自服務(wù)鏈。如果您已經(jīng)獲得了虛擬網(wǎng)絡(luò)功能 (VNF) 的速度和效率,那么您當(dāng)然不希望通過(guò)緩慢的手動(dòng)網(wǎng)絡(luò)配置來(lái)將這些東西連接在一起。SDN再次在這里發(fā)揮作用。通過(guò)能夠通過(guò)軟件有效地管理服務(wù)鏈中 VNF 之間的網(wǎng)絡(luò)路徑和 QoS,您可以實(shí)現(xiàn)整體上市時(shí)間和易于部署的改進(jìn),這是對(duì)傳統(tǒng)做事方式的巨大飛躍。
伴隨 NFV 網(wǎng)絡(luò)架構(gòu)轉(zhuǎn)變的文化變革
由于網(wǎng)絡(luò)內(nèi)部工作對(duì)外界(包括網(wǎng)絡(luò)管理和客戶端應(yīng)用程序)的相對(duì)不透明和不可訪問(wèn)性,網(wǎng)絡(luò)工程仍然是 IT 和電信基礎(chǔ)設(shè)施中自動(dòng)化程度最低的領(lǐng)域之一。目前的假設(shè)是,網(wǎng)絡(luò)的設(shè)計(jì)、組裝和測(cè)試是一個(gè)緩慢的、工程師驅(qū)動(dòng)的過(guò)程,因?yàn)樗枰罅康闹R(shí)、經(jīng)驗(yàn)和直覺(jué)來(lái)理解事物的工作原理。因此,網(wǎng)絡(luò)往往具有遵循瀑布模型的更改和認(rèn)證周期。一個(gè)典型的例子是,驗(yàn)證新的網(wǎng)絡(luò)升級(jí)和服務(wù)提供商設(shè)置的更改需要大約 6 到 9 個(gè)月的時(shí)間。
這就是問(wèn)題所在:SDN 和 NFV 背后的整個(gè)理念都基于敏捷性——構(gòu)思和部署 VNF 服務(wù)鏈的速度;創(chuàng)建應(yīng)用程序的速度,這些應(yīng)用程序可以通過(guò)集中式控制器簡(jiǎn)單地與統(tǒng)一的網(wǎng)絡(luò)控制平面 API 對(duì)話,并從網(wǎng)絡(luò)請(qǐng)求特定服務(wù)。這一切都很好,但是如果您需要花費(fèi)大量時(shí)間來(lái)驗(yàn)證網(wǎng)絡(luò)更改,這將成為一個(gè)真正的瓶頸。想象一下,推出和/或升級(jí)了一個(gè)新的支持 SDN 的應(yīng)用程序——您必須證明它可以針對(duì)網(wǎng)絡(luò)中的所有底層硬件工作。畢竟,僅僅因?yàn)楸毙?API 有效,并不意味著南行方向的一切都會(huì)上漲。如果您試圖讓敏捷的應(yīng)用程序開(kāi)發(fā)周期快速推出新功能,
這是自上而下的應(yīng)用程序視圖,但它也適用于自下而上。大型網(wǎng)絡(luò)不斷更改操作系統(tǒng)映像、進(jìn)行硬件升級(jí)等。你如何證明應(yīng)用層將與新的網(wǎng)絡(luò)層一起工作?
這些問(wèn)題不僅與 SDN 有關(guān),還與 SDN 有關(guān)。讓我們只考慮 NFV 的認(rèn)證挑戰(zhàn)。我們知道,使用 NFV,您可以快速創(chuàng)建任何服務(wù)鏈,并具有足夠的靈活性來(lái)響應(yīng)客戶機(jī)會(huì)和請(qǐng)求、改進(jìn)服務(wù)產(chǎn)品等。之前的限制機(jī)制是硬件重新配置,但有了它,就沒(méi)有結(jié)束您可以鍛煉的創(chuàng)造力和敏捷性。糟糕,這聽(tīng)起來(lái)確實(shí)像是 QA 的噩夢(mèng),不是嗎?服務(wù)鏈 QA 矩陣會(huì)增長(zhǎng)到多大?好吧,無(wú)窮大是雙曲線的,但我們只能說(shuō)它非常大并且不斷增長(zhǎng)。您如何應(yīng)對(duì)不斷涌現(xiàn)的新服務(wù)鏈進(jìn)行認(rèn)證?
答案是內(nèi)部網(wǎng)絡(luò)運(yùn)營(yíng)必須經(jīng)歷文化變革——從擁有智慧、經(jīng)驗(yàn)和超凡直覺(jué)的全能網(wǎng)絡(luò)工程英雄統(tǒng)治流程,轉(zhuǎn)向協(xié)作、敏捷和自動(dòng)化流程。AT&T 在其 Domain 2.0 白皮書(shū)中描述了該公司將笨拙的電信巨頭轉(zhuǎn)變?yōu)殪`活的軟件/數(shù)字企業(yè)的愿景,它是這樣說(shuō)的:
“在實(shí)現(xiàn)這一愿景 [Domain 2.0] 之前還有很多工作要做,包括從網(wǎng)絡(luò)技術(shù)轉(zhuǎn)向軟件工程,從運(yùn)營(yíng)商運(yùn)營(yíng)模型轉(zhuǎn)向云“DevOps”模型。我們還看到了一個(gè)重要的支點(diǎn),即擁抱敏捷開(kāi)發(fā)而不是現(xiàn)有的瀑布模型?!?/p>
在與 AT&T 內(nèi)部的網(wǎng)絡(luò)工程師交談后,我可以說(shuō)有一種明顯的感覺(jué),即你要么正在進(jìn)行這段旅程,要么在一定時(shí)間內(nèi)不會(huì)上火車(chē)。用一位工程師的話來(lái)說(shuō):“要么你改變,要么你在 AT&T 沒(méi)有未來(lái)的職業(yè)生涯?!?/p>
這種文化變革是如何發(fā)生的?顯然,自上而下的管理任務(wù)具有關(guān)鍵影響,但實(shí)際上對(duì)于擁有大量網(wǎng)絡(luò)基礎(chǔ)設(shè)施(尤其是擁有數(shù)年甚至數(shù)十年積累的資產(chǎn))的組織而言,主要目標(biāo)之一需要瞄準(zhǔn)敏捷/基于不斷增加的基礎(chǔ)設(shè)施自動(dòng)化的連續(xù)循環(huán)。尤其不能低估基礎(chǔ)設(shè)施自動(dòng)化。
讓我們?cè)倏匆幌聹y(cè)試周期,因?yàn)樗且粋€(gè)很好的例子。由于手動(dòng)設(shè)置網(wǎng)絡(luò)測(cè)試平臺(tái)環(huán)境可能需要大量的(而且非常耗時(shí))周期,工程師一旦掌握了正確的設(shè)備就不愿意放棄該設(shè)備,這是可以理解的。以工程師為中心的手動(dòng)工作方式意味著(即使數(shù)百萬(wàn)美元的設(shè)備閑置)每小時(shí)減少數(shù)千美元的資本支出減記并消耗昂貴的空間、電力和不間斷的冷卻,因?yàn)樗浅:币?jiàn)找到能勝任這項(xiàng)工作的熟練工程師。但是,如果您可以自動(dòng)化整個(gè)測(cè)試基礎(chǔ)架構(gòu),使其像云一樣運(yùn)行,那么 QA 工程師就會(huì)專注于他們的知識(shí)真正重要的地方——設(shè)計(jì)和自動(dòng)化越來(lái)越廣泛和深入的測(cè)試,以確保應(yīng)用程序、服務(wù)鏈、和基礎(chǔ)設(shè)施都很好地結(jié)合在一起。如果你以這種方式思考事情,那么就會(huì)有一些重要的收獲。首先,需要有一個(gè)現(xiàn)實(shí)的評(píng)估:
? 網(wǎng)絡(luò)基礎(chǔ)設(shè)施的當(dāng)前狀態(tài)和可能的演進(jìn)過(guò)程——假裝沒(méi)有數(shù)百萬(wàn)或數(shù)十億美元的非SDN、全金屬網(wǎng)絡(luò)設(shè)備并且它們不會(huì)消失是沒(méi)有好處的很快。將 DevOps 文化視為僅適用于最新基礎(chǔ)架構(gòu)的東西也是不明智的。硬件的現(xiàn)實(shí)是它必須成為文化變革的一部分。
? 工程團(tuán)隊(duì)的技能組合和態(tài)度——嘗試從具有 DevOps 背景的網(wǎng)絡(luò)公司聘請(qǐng)軟件工程師來(lái)“改造”一切是非常誘人的。如果協(xié)作是關(guān)鍵,那么設(shè)置人員孤島也無(wú)濟(jì)于事。文化變革與老虎隊(duì)不同。話雖如此,顯然還需要有領(lǐng)導(dǎo)者,而且評(píng)估組織中誰(shuí)愿意改變以及誰(shuí)決心追隨并抵制也很重要。除了態(tài)度之外,認(rèn)識(shí)到當(dāng)前團(tuán)隊(duì)由 98% 的受過(guò)供應(yīng)商培訓(xùn)的領(lǐng)域?qū)<医M成,這些專家可能具有一些腳本技能,但不是專業(yè)的軟件程序員,這意味著您必須尋找能夠利用他們的技能的自動(dòng)化和流程的方法,而無(wú)需失去他們的專業(yè)知識(shí)和貢獻(xiàn)。
網(wǎng)絡(luò)基礎(chǔ)設(shè)施:自動(dòng)化一切
以認(rèn)識(shí)到上述現(xiàn)實(shí)的方式對(duì)所有基礎(chǔ)設(shè)施進(jìn)行自動(dòng)化的不懈承諾將產(chǎn)生大量富有成效的成果。第一階段可能是從手動(dòng)操作的設(shè)計(jì)和 QA 實(shí)驗(yàn)室轉(zhuǎn)移到類(lèi)似云的自動(dòng)化基礎(chǔ)設(shè)施,盡管設(shè)計(jì)和測(cè)試的完成方式仍然非常手動(dòng)。這可能看起來(lái)很簡(jiǎn)單,但它確實(shí)需要文化變革,因?yàn)槿藗儽谎?qǐng)采用新的工作和思維方式,因?yàn)樗麄冎浪麄兊目山桓冻晒匀辉谶^(guò)去難以滿足的相同期限內(nèi)。許多網(wǎng)絡(luò)制造商和電信公司的經(jīng)驗(yàn)表明,僅這一步就可以在某些情況下將測(cè)試周期從幾個(gè)月大幅縮短到幾天。
成功激勵(lì)人們加入。自上而下致力于繼續(xù)迭代、協(xié)作的改進(jìn)過(guò)程,將利用這些早期成果,幫助組織走上基于動(dòng)態(tài)沙盒的網(wǎng)絡(luò)服務(wù)和拓?fù)湓O(shè)計(jì)、網(wǎng)絡(luò)測(cè)試自動(dòng)化、數(shù)據(jù)驅(qū)動(dòng)的網(wǎng)絡(luò)測(cè)試、持續(xù)集成、和持續(xù)部署(如果相關(guān))。
審核編輯:郭婷
-
控制器
+關(guān)注
關(guān)注
114文章
17108瀏覽量
184283 -
物聯(lián)網(wǎng)
+關(guān)注
關(guān)注
2931文章
46246瀏覽量
392493 -
自動(dòng)化
+關(guān)注
關(guān)注
29文章
5784瀏覽量
84857
發(fā)布評(píng)論請(qǐng)先 登錄
評(píng)論